Description
Saturday, May 3 from 10:00 a.m. to Noon.
One of the best places to observe truly spectacular flower displays is on a portion of the Ice Age Trail in Riverside Park, called Devil's Staircase. On this hike you will be able to see entire hillsides covered with the blooms of Dutchman's breeches and anemones. Depending on yearly variations in bloom time, there may also be hepaticas, violets, spring beauty, wild ginger and trilliums. After an initial steep climb up a short staircase, the trail runs across slopes adjacent to the Rock River. Trail conditions are good, and the hiking difficulty is moderate; a hiking stick is recommended for those who have balance issues. This hike is co-sponsored by the Friends of Riverside Park and the Rock County Conservationists. Meet at the far north parking lot of Janesville’s Riverside Park near the pavilion next to the Devil’s Staircase Trail. Limited 25 participants.
